Half-wave-crystal channeling of relativistic heavy ions at super-FRS GSI/FAIR
2021
Abstract The computer simulations of relativistic heavy ions channeling through the half-wavelength crystal showed the similarity of trajectories and angular distributions for ions with close ratios of the mass number A and the ion charge Ze. We studied the deflection efficiency of 300 MeV/u and 30 GeV/u 129Xe, 208Pb, 238U ions by a single tungsten half-wavelength crystal. In addition, we showed that the assembly of two sequentially placed and rotated by the critical channeling angle half-wavelength crystals increases twice the deflection angle.
